After buffet breakfast you will be ccompanied by a local English speaking guide for an insight into the history of this once divided city. See the places where Adolf Hitler rose to power and conducted his World War II campaigns against the allied forces. Berlin, the city where the Soviet East met the Capitalist West during the cold war. This is where Sir Winston Churchill coined the phrase “Iron Curtain” to describe the division of Europe. Today you see the famous Berlin Wall that divided the city till reunification in 1990. Once seen as a symbol of inhumanity, today it is seen as a symbol of peace. Stop at the Brandenburg Gate in Pariser Platz. This is the most important classical monument in Germany. Built in the 18th century, this symbol of the city was also for a long time a symbol of the partition of Germany. Next, we take you to see the Reichstag - the German Parliament Building. This 19th century building boasts of a 21st century glass and steel cupola. Visit Alexander Platz, the city centre where you will see the World Time Clock. (B, L, D) Day 01 Day 02 Day 03 Day 04 Day 05 Wieliczka Salt mines - guided city tour of Krakow. After buffet breakfast, we proceed to Wieliczka Salt mines - one of the oldest in all of Europe. Over the centuries, devout and superstitious miners have carved fabulous figures, monuments and altarpieces out of its salt walls. These amazing works of art, in addition to the mine’s historical importance, have earned Salt Mine a place on the UNESCO World Cultural Heritage list. Later we proceed for an Indian lunch. Later on we go for a guided city tour of Krakow - Meander through the medieval town centre, the ancient capital of Poland. Admire the Main Market square, arguably one of the world’s most beautiful plazas, and the splendid Renaissance Cloth Hall. See twin-towered St Mary’s Church and learn the story of the brave trumpeter who died while warning his city of a Mongol invasion. See Jagiellonian University, one of the oldest universities in the world and Wavell Hill with its great Castle and Cathedral.
